About

Dr. Erik Beyer, MD is a Cardiovascular Surgery Specialist in Lauderdale Lakes, FL and has 30 years experience. They graduated from University of Tennessee College of Medicine in 1994 and completed a residency at Cleveland Clinic|University Of Texas Hospital At Houston.They currently practice at Practice and are affiliated with Delray Medical Center, Florida Medical Center and North Shore Medical Center. At present, Dr. Beyer received an average rating of 4.9/5 from patients and has been reviewed 72 times. Their office accepts new patients. Dr. Beyer also speaks German and Spanish. Dr. Beyer is board certified in General Surgery and accepts multiple insurance plans.

What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
